This OM-28 1931 Authentic is in very good condition with some some playwear present and a minor ding on the underside of the headstock. Its Adirondack Spruce top has a highly pronounced grain that is accented with a classic herringbone pattern around the perimeter. The ebony fingerboard is exceptionally dark and the "Soft V Neck" profile is highly comfortable to play at all positions up and down the neck. This particular guitar is fitted with a beautifully figured Madagascar Rosewood back and sides book match that has a unique grain pattern near the lower bout. The antique white binding has been repaired by our in-house techs between the right upper and lower bout. Other areas of the binding has been repaired in the past by another shop. The action is currently at a comfortable playing height, but the saddle is low and may need further attention down the road to keep the action at a comfortable measurement. Currently the guitar plays wonderfully and has a rich tone with lots of playability. The guitar comes with the original hard shell case.

For context, I’m a seasoned woodworker and always evaluate tools with the price in mind. This seemed like a good deal and in fact when it arrived, it looked and felt like reasonable quality for the price. Unhappily, the first bookshelf I drilled was off from side to side by almost 3 mm which would make a really wobbly shelf situation. It took a while to figure out what was happening, but I finally realized the metal bushings that guide the drill bit are so soft that they cored out from contact with the bit even though I was cautious to not put the bit in under power but to get it in the bushing and aligned before drilling. Still, the bushings started angling immediately. So when you then use those angled bushings to set the pin for the next series, it’s off by a little bit. Then the next is off by a little more…. By the time I drilled holes up and down a 6’ high shelf, the bushings were out of square, the holes were 3 mm out of alignment, and the shelf sides were firewood. Back to the drawing board and this goes in the trash, I’m afraid.
